Twinline

Twinline is a national, confidential, support, listening and information service for all parents of twins, triplets and more, and the professionals involved in their care.

It is staffed by trained volunteers who are parents of multiples, and can answer questions on many topics including slepp, feeding, crying, behaviour, discipline or special needs.

Often all the caller needs is five minutes breathing space, a chat or a listening ear from someone who can identify with their situation.


Telephone: 0800 138 0509

The service operates from 10am to 1pm and from 7pm to 10pm, every day, all year round.
